> for a laptop with only usb support, a friend of mine is searching for a
> good supported usb device for linux... he was thinking about the Tascam
> US-122, good one? Other suggestions?

I have the US-122. They are pretty cheap on ebay now. The mic preamps
are transparent and unusually quiet. As was mentioned, you have to load
firmware... it takes an hour of surfing and tinkering to get it to work.

This worked with my old Dell, but it broke, and I got a newer IBM thinkpad
on ebay. I think it was an 800MHz PentiumII or III. I could never get
the US-122 to work with the onboard USB. The sound was very choppy.
I tried a PCMCIA USB card, thinking it might be the USB controller,
but it wasn't quite able to fully power the unit.
